Curious - AC694 last night (15th Feb)

So AC694 (YYZ-YYT) flew to St John's before turning around and heading back to YYZ. We'd had a two day snowstorm but the airport was open by this point & other flights were landing.

Many annoyed pax on social media & reported here: http://vocm.com/news/stranded-passen...ck-to-toronto/ . What is curious is the airport going out of their way to say this was an AC issue rather than an airport one. i.e. the runway was open.

EF comments: (I didn't realise that I subscribed to this bit of the service): "FLIGHT R
ETURNED TO YYZ DUE TO YYT WEATHER AND RUNWAY CONCERNS". Oddly, 680 (A319) landed around the same time I think with no issue. 694 had been upgauged to a 763.

Certainly a difference in opinion between the airport & the airline & interesting to see the airport be so public about it.
